Unison Systems is seeking an AI Engineering Manager to lead enterprise-scale delivery of LLM and applied machine learning solutions for our client in Denver, CO.

This is an onsite contract role (5 days/week, 8-5 MST) running through year-end. You will report to director/VP level and own end-to-end AI/ML product strategy, team leadership, and execution in a business-critical environment. The role requires deep hands-on LLM expertise paired with strong people leadership and the ability to translate complex AI concepts into clear strategies for senior executives.

Responsibilities

  • Build, mentor, and scale teams of data scientists, ML engineers, data engineers, and software engineers
  • Set technical standards, provide coaching for senior talent, and foster accountability, delivery, and innovation
  • Lead design, development, and deployment of AI/ML solutions from ideation through production
  • Own LLM strategy including model selection, fine-tuning, RAG architectures, prompt engineering, and agentic workflows
  • Partner with architecture and platform teams to establish standards and best practices for enterprise AI
  • Define and communicate an AI/ML roadmap aligned to business strategy
  • Identify high-value AI opportunities, prioritize use cases, and articulate value, tradeoffs, and risks to executives
  • Collaborate with product, engineering, operations, risk/compliance, and business teams to translate requirements into solutions
  • Drive execution using Agile methods; establish KPIs, OKRs, and success metrics
  • Prepare executive-ready updates, business cases, and technical briefings
  • Champion ethical, responsible, and compliant AI practices

Requirements

  • 8+ years of people management experience leading technical teams (ML, data science, data engineering, or software engineering)
  • 8+ years of applied ML/data science experience in industry
  • 4+ years of hands-on LLM experience including fine-tuning, RAG architectures, prompt engineering, and agentic systems
  • Proven track record of delivering AI/ML systems to production in complex, real-world environments
  • Experience deploying products at Fortune 100 or equivalent enterprise scale
  • Exceptional written and verbal communication skills with demonstrated ability to influence executives
  • Strong Agile leadership and program management skills
  • Business-focused mindset-able to frame AI decisions in terms of outcomes, ROI, and risk
  • Comfort operating in ambiguity and balancing experimentation with discipline
  • Advanced degree in Computer Science, AI/ML, Statistics, or related field (preferred)
  • Hands-on experience with modern AI/ML stacks (Python, PyTorch/TensorFlow, vector databases, MLOps frameworks, cloud AI services) (preferred)
